Certification & difficulty

Advanced Open Water - advanced conditions (currents/depth); dive within your training.

Snorkelling

Not a snorkel site - Limited - shallow coral garden near the top of the wall (~5-15m) can be snorkeled only in calm, current-slack conditions; not a beginner snorkel site

Safety notes

Strong/unpredictable currents including possible down-currents on the wall face; remote location with limited emergency/O2 support; blast (dynamite) fishing reported elsewhere in the wider Bira area
